Memory phrase (Mnemonic) for: 犬


Hanzi-Trainer
 

Meaning

dog

Pronunciation

quǎn

Explanation

The symbol for large (= big man with outstretched arms) and an extra line , which is understood as a dog. [This: also means 'dog'. But is more used in written/formal.]

Mnemonic

The big man holds in his arms: a dog.

Radicals

dog(Shows a big person with with outspread arms who holds a small dog )

Vocabulary

阿拉斯加雪撬犬 Ā lā sī jiā Xuě qiào quǎn Alaskan Malamute
贵宾犬 guì bīn quǎn poodle
蜀犬吠日 shǔ quǎn fèi rì lit. Sichuan dogs bark at the sun (idiom); fig. a simpleton will marvel at even the most universal known.; alludes to the Sichan foggy weather where it's uncommon to see a sunny day
